WebJan 4, 2011 · Finding the “sweet spot” for a Fender Telecaster ‘s neck pickup height can require some trial and error. We start with the pickup about 3/32″ from the strings, when the strings are held down at the highest fret. But you’ll probably need to adjust it up and down to find the best combination of output, openness, and sustain.

WebBeginning with Maximum height: Set the gap at the neck pickup (both E strings only) to 2mm or 5/64", but not less than that. Set the gap at the middle pickup (both E strings only) to 2mm or 5/64", but not less than 1.75mm or 1/16"+. Set the gap at the bridge pickup (both E strings only) to 1.5mm or 1/16", but not less than that.

This is another personal preference of mine, as I’m primarily bridge-pickup player, but it also sweetens the middle position. mongolian restaurants near my locationWebPickup height: The distance of the pickup in relation to the strings will affect the tone as the magnetic field will not be disturbed in the same way when you play. Typically, the tone will be clearer and the sustain longer if the pickup is moved away from the strings. If you want higher output and more bass, move the pickup closer to the strings. mongolian restaurant murfreesboro tnWebUse the two pivot adjustment screws to achieve the desired overall string height.
